Monday, February 2, 2004

Zo, Are You Ein Loyal Member Uf Zee Party?

The South Carolina state Democratic Party has decided to force every voter to sign a pledge swearing that they are true Democrats I'm not so sure the Democrats' loyalty oath is even legal. South Carolina code 7-11-20 deals with primaries vs. non-binding "advisory" votes. If it's a primary, it must be held according to state law, which means no loyalty oath is allowed. Since delegates will be apportioned based on the outcome of Tuesday's vote, I don't see how the SC primary can be considered merely "advisory."

I'm no specialist in Constitutional law, but this doesn't sound kosher. Since it's liberals running the show, i doubt anyone will challenge it. Has the ACLU, et al, ever jumped in where they were really needed?